Bernard “Bernie” Sullivan, Jr., 59, of Manchester, Iowa, died at his home on Monday, April 12, 2010, following a long battle with cancer.
A Memorial Mass will be held at 11:00 a.m., Thursday, April 15, 2010 at St. Mary Catholic Church in Manchester. The family will greet friends from 4:00 pm until 8:00 pm on Wednesday, April 14, with a Scripture service at 7:30 pm at the Bohnenkamp-Murdoch Funeral Home & Cremation Service, Manchester, Iowa. Inurnment will be in the Oakland Cemetery.
Bernie was born on February 19, 1951, in Manchester, Iowa, the son of Bernard F. & LaVonda M. (Miller) Sullivan, Sr. He attended West Delaware High School in Manchester. On September 9, 1972, Bernie was united in marriage to Wilma M. Cornwell in Freeport, Illinois. Bernie worked as assembler for 32 years at Henderson Manufacturing, Manchester, retiring in 2007. He also worked part-time for D.J. Repair in Manchester.
Bernie was a member of St. Mary Catholic Church in Manchester. He enjoyed watching NASCAR racing and truck pulling and working on his cars.
Bernie is survived by his wife, Wilma M. Sullivan of Manchester; three children, John (Jessica) Sullivan of Oelwein, William (Heather) Sullivan of Manchester, and Mindy (Tony) Moll of Greeley; nine grandchildren; two brothers, Michael (Brenda) Sullivan of Marion and Charles (Wilma) Sullivan of Lake Placid, Florida; a sister Wendy (Bill) Carpenter of Manchester; his mother-in-law, Barbara Cornwell of Galena, KS; brothers and sisters-in-law, Theodore Cornwell, Randy (Jean) Cornwell, Rodney (Chris) Cornwell all of Tulsa, OK, John (Bonnie) Cornwell of Ripley, TN, Mick (Sharlene) Cornwell of Manchester, Penny (Barry) Smith of Portland, OR, Elizabeth McCarty of Glenda, KS, and Barbara (Wade) Gaskins of Ripley, TN.
Bernie was preceded in death by his parents, Bernard & LaVonda Sullivan, Sr. and by two brothers, John and David Sullivan.
In lieu of flowers, the family requests memorials may be directed to the American Cancer Society.
